Business changes in an eye blink. Executives are constantly bombarded with a plethora of potential opportunities and obstacles to growth. The challenges to success are relentless, and great ideas are simply not enough.
In a world of rapid, constant change, managers do not have the time to thoroughly evaluate every option on the table. Based on the premise that creative and logical decisions that are rapid and executable are better than optimal solutions that come too late, this course covers a proven process for solving complex problems quickly while overcoming barriers to profitability.
Using a combination of analytical and creative processes, participants will leave with a powerful tool kit (including the rule of thirds, logic diagrams, and interview techniques) for effectively and efficiently developing achievable goals, identifying real solutions, exploring plausible alternatives, creating realistic work plans, and driving execution - all without sacrificing thoroughness or creativity. The net result: better solutions developed faster to positively affect your growth, profitability, and ability to service your customers.
In this working session, participants will begin the process of resolving a current challenge in their organization. Competency will be developed through group exercises, discussions and practice of new and proven techniques. The course also includes exciting real-life examples from a variety of organizations, and provides powerful benefits to executives, managers and consultants.

Who Should Attend
Executives and managers from all functional areas, change agents and professionals with responsibility for improving organizational effectiveness. Leaders managing cross-functional teams or task forces, management consultants, and those who are transitioning into consulting/problem solving roles will also benefit.
This program is applicable to all for-profit and not-for-profit organizations.
